Bayesian Aggregation of Multiple Annotations Enhances Rare Variant Association Testing
2025-03-04
Abstract excerpt
Gene-level rare variant association tests (RVATs) are essential for uncovering disease mechanisms and identifying potential drug targets. Advances in sequence-based machine learning have expanded the availability of variant pathogenicity scores, offering new opportunities to improve variant prioritization for RVATs.
